Personnel moves du jour:  DJ is coming back, a few are headed out the door

Written by: NY Warrior

First the good news -- Dominic James announced at the basketball banquet tonight that he will return to Marquette for his senior season.  Bravo, Dominic!  Now it is time for DJ to chase down and pass George Thompson as MU's all-time leading scorer, and lead the team to a fourth consecutive NCAA tournament bid.

Now for the departures.....freshman SG Scott Christopherson and 2008 commit Nick Williams have each been granted their release from Marquette University.  Adios, fellas.

Williams was given an unconditional release meaning he can go to any school he chooses.  It is interesting that MU afforded Williams complete freedom.  In the past for kids already in the program, Marquette was prescriptive as to the places a player was eligible to transfer to.  Hello, IU?

It appears the next shoe to drop could be Trevor Mbakwe if you believe the message boards.

Even before these departures, Andy Katz didn't think much of Marquette, failing to include the Golden Eagles in his early pre-season top 25.  Whatever, Andy.

Meanwhile, Buzz Williams jets off to New Jersey on Friday morning in an attempt to re-recruit Tyshawn Taylor, the combo guard from St Anthony's who has also asked for his release from Marquette.  In a Q/A with Adam Zagoria today, Taylor offered MU fans a ray of hope (and contradicted remarks made by his coach last week):

Williams was given an unconditional release meaning he can go to any school he chooses.  It is interesting that MU afforded Williams complete freedom.  In the past for kids already in the program, Marquette was prescriptive as to the places a player was eligible to transfer to.  Hello, IU?

A correction - I gather from this article that Nick Williams can NOT go to a Big East school.  However, it's just a Big East thing - not a Marquette thing.
Quote
Serving as a double whammy for both Dixon and Taylor is a Big East rule prohibiting a student-athlete from committing to a second conference school after he or she has already signed with one.
